**Mgmt Meeting Minutes — Retiring the Brightline Range**

Quick recap for sales leads at Fenholt Supplies: we agreed to retire the Brightline fixture range by year-end. Remaining stock moves to clearance pricing next month, and accounts on standing orders get migrated to the Lumetta range. Trade-in incentives were approved in principle. The confidential note on next steps sits just below.

board note of bajof-bajeg: The pricing group signed off on a budget of $13.4 million for Project Sildor. The renewal with Lamixek Holdings closes at $48.9 million a year, 49 percent above the last contract.

CI note — Pellarch pipeline. If the nightly build breaks on a transitive dependency, remember our pinning policy: all direct deps are locked in the manifest, but transitive ranges float until the weekly freeze. Do not hand-edit the lockfile; regenerate it with the resolver image the Quillmont team maintains, then rerun the affected stage twice to rule out cache poisoning. Flaky resolution usually means a mirror sync lag, not a real conflict. When filing the incident, quote the build token appearing below.

pipeline stamp: htk21_0e1a1ddcdb5bfd88d6dd6

# RouteForge Changelog — Default Changes

Driver-assignment heuristic v4.2. Changed defaults: proximity weight lowered, idle-time weight raised, and the fallback radius now expands in two steps rather than one. Security-relevant: assignment audit logging is now enabled by default and the heuristic no longer reads driver ratings from the legacy feed. No changes to auth or data retention. All tunables were moved into a single signed config bundle. The new default values follow.

config for badup-kagap:
OLIOX_PIN=5344
OLIOX_METRICS_HOST=metrics.oliox.zemvarcorp.corp
OLIOX_LOG_LEVEL=error
OLIOX_TENANT=pelox

**Vendor note: Inkmill markdown pipeline**

Rendering for Parchway docs is outsourced to Inkmill under an annual contract, renewing each March. They handle sanitization and PDF export; we own the upload queue. SLA: 4-hour response on rendering failures. Escalate only after two failed retries. Their support desk is reachable at the address below.

billing contact of hahaf-baguf = zorael.tammir.jorius@sivrelhq.internal